ceph: fix printk format warnings in file.c
authorRandy Dunlap <rdunlap@infradead.org>
Fri, 19 Apr 2013 21:20:07 +0000 (14:20 -0700)
committerSage Weil <sage@inktank.com>
Thu, 2 May 2013 04:18:57 +0000 (21:18 -0700)
Fix printk format warnings by using %zd for 'ssize_t' variables:

fs/ceph/file.c:751:2: warning: format '%ld' expects argument of type 'long int', but argument 11 has type 'ssize_t' [-Wformat]
fs/ceph/file.c:762:2: warning: format '%ld' expects argument of type 'long int', but argument 11 has type 'ssize_t' [-Wformat]

Signed-off-by: Randy Dunlap <rdunlap@infradead.org>
Cc: ceph-devel@vger.kernel.org
Signed-off-by: Sage Weil <sage@inktank.com>
fs/ceph/file.c

index c639d9279fdd02e95ce075e129695540d120f4d3..7e94dcb66d92da556a6336f530116794ef12277e 100644 (file)
@@ -747,7 +747,7 @@ retry_snap:
                goto out;
        }
 
-       dout("aio_write %p %llx.%llx %llu~%ld getting caps. i_size %llu\n",
+       dout("aio_write %p %llx.%llx %llu~%zd getting caps. i_size %llu\n",
             inode, ceph_vinop(inode), pos, count, inode->i_size);
        if (fi->fmode & CEPH_FILE_MODE_LAZY)
                want = CEPH_CAP_FILE_BUFFER | CEPH_CAP_FILE_LAZYIO;
@@ -758,7 +758,7 @@ retry_snap:
        if (err < 0)
                goto out;
 
-       dout("aio_write %p %llx.%llx %llu~%ld got cap refs on %s\n",
+       dout("aio_write %p %llx.%llx %llu~%zd got cap refs on %s\n",
             inode, ceph_vinop(inode), pos, count, ceph_cap_string(got));
 
        if ((got & (CEPH_CAP_FILE_BUFFER|CEPH_CAP_FILE_LAZYIO)) == 0 ||